Hakutsuru Sake Brewery Museum

4 Chome 5-5 Sumiyoshi Minamimachi, Higashinada, Kobe, Hyogo

Occupying two floors of a former sake brewery, the Hakutsuru Sake Brewery Museum introduces visitors to the history and process of sake brewing. Life-sized figures recreate scenes from the traditional brewing process, and brochures are available in English to help non-Japanese speakers get their bearings.

Tasting sake is a quintessentially Japanese experience, and visiting this informative museum is an excellent primer for learning about the popular drink.   • Reservations are required for groups of 10 or more visitors.

  • Admission to the museum is free.

  • After your tour, you can get free sake samples at the on-site museum shop.

The Hakutsuru Sake Brewery Museum is located in the eastern part of Kobe and is easy to reach by public transportation. The Hanshin Sumiyoshi is a 5-minute walk away, while the JR Sumiyoshi station is a 15-minute walk. The Hankyu Mikage station, with direct connections to Osaka on the Tokaido-Sanyo Line, is a 10-minute taxi ride away.

The Hakutsuru Sake Brewery Museum is open throughout the year, except during the annual Obon festivities in August and the New Year's holiday, when it's usually closed for just over a week. The museum also occasionally closes for maintenance, so it's a good idea to call to confirm it will be open before you visit.
